Alfa Romeo about to be confirmed with Sauber?

If the name ofAlfa Romeo has been discussed in the paddocks for several months, the arrival of the Italian brand owned by Fiat Chrysler Automobiles (which no longer owns Ferrari since last year) could soon be confirmed for next season.

Clean F1 Team is preparing to confirm that it will rebadge the Power Units developed by Ferrari by taking the name of Alfa Romeo, in the manner of what is done Red Bull Racing with the motors Renault rebadged Tag Heuer.

The Swiss team would take the opportunity to confirm its 2018 crew which would unsurprisingly be made up of Charles Leclerc, reigning champion of the F2 with Prema, as well as Marcus Ericsson. The Monegasque would thus take the place of Pascal Wehrlein.

Alfa Romeo has evolved as an engine manufacturer in F1 since 1950 before leaving the discipline in 1987. The Italian brand won 12 Grand Prix victories and established itself as a Manufacturer in the early 1950s with Juan Manuel Fangio and Giuseppe Farina.
